To make this corn chowder, I started by adding some butter, diced onion and garlic puree to a large pot over medium-high heat.

butter, diced onions and garlic puree in a soup pot

I cooked the onions until they were translucent and then I added some flour to the pot. 

flour added to diced onions and butter in soup pot

I stirred everything together well and let the flour cook for a few minutes, stirring occasionally.

flour, butter and diced onions cooking in soup pot

Then I whisked in a can of chicken broth and some milk.

milk and chicken broth in soup pot with whisk

I brought the liquid to a boil, and then added some canned corn, cream style corn, real bacon bits, salt, pepper and chives to the pot.

I stirred all of the ingredients together and then reduced the heat to medium.

corn chowder simmering in pot

I left the soup to simmer for ten minutes, stirring occasionally.

Then the soup was ready to serve.

Easy Corn Chowder with Bacon

Yield: 6 people as main dish
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Total Time: 25 minutes

Easy Corn Chowder with Bacon is a hearty soup recipe perfect for cold weather. This creamy soup is loaded with corn and real bacon bits.

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up butter
  • 1 yellow onion, diced
  • 1/2 tsbp garlic puree
  • 1/4 cup flour
  • 10.5 oz condensed chicken broth
  • 3 cups milk
  • 17.5 oz canned whole kernel corn, ( 2 x 8.75oz cans)
  • 8.25 oz cream style corn
  • 1 cup real bacon bits
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p pepper
  • 1 tbsp dried chives

Instructions

  1. Dump butter, diced onions and garlic puree into a large pot over medium-high heat.
  2. Cook until onions are translucent.
  3. Add the flour to the pot and stir well. Leave flour to cook for three minutes, stirring occasionally.
  4. Add chicken broth to the pot and whisk well. 
  5. Add milk and whisk again.
  6. Bring the liquid to a boil.
  7. Add the canned corn, cream style corn, bacon bits, salt, pepper and chives to the pot. Stir well.
  8. Reduce heat to medium and leave soup to simmer for ten minutes, stirring occasionally.
  9. Serve and enjoy!
